Crucially, this icon adheres strictly to Flat Design principles—meaning it avoids gradients, shadows, 3D effects, or textures that could introduce visual noise or complexity. Instead, it relies on clean lines, simple shapes, and a single-color palette with strategic accents. Flat design prioritizes readability and scalability across various screen sizes and devices—from smartphones to tablets to large digital kiosks in airports. This makes the icon highly adaptable for use in user interfaces (UIs), dashboards, navigation menus, or even as an app logo within travel technology platforms such as booking services, route planners, or personal travel journals.
